Statistics

Total Visits

Views
A ... 323

Total Visits per Month

August 2025 September 2025 October 2025 November 2025 December 2025 January 2026 February 2026
A ... 10 100 44 10 6 8 6

File Downloads

Views
163A.jpg 83

Top Country Views

Views
Portugal 100
United States 55
Brazil 49
Vietnam 31
Argentina 9
Germany 8
Australia 7
China 5
Ireland 5
Spain 4

Top City Views

Views
Barcelos 43
San Mateo 15
Porto 10
Ho Chi Minh City 7
Braga 5
Hanoi 4
Vila Nova de Famalicao 4
Vila Nova de Gaia 4
Curitiba 3
São Paulo 3